Just ordered new door rubbers from Classic.
how difficult is it to replace the seals and is there anything I should know?
Do i need to selastic them in or do they just press into the doors?
Do i need to remove the pin of the hinge?
vw54 - May 30th, 2010 at 05:44 PM
they just push in
no glue
make sure u clean ALL the old crap n glue out first use some prepsol to remove
ues a wooden wedge to help push into place if the rubbers dont fit then give me a ring

Good to see You have them in OK...
most probably one of the easiest things to fit in a beetle..
although I have seen people shut the door and it chops off part of the door rubber,,
I fitted mine then left the doors shut for a while..
I rubbed armorall all over it so it would slide when closed...
I still use armorall on them now & then...
